What Does a Mean Corpuscular Hemoglobin (MCH) Level of 23.5 pg Mean?

The Mean Corpuscular Hemoglobin (MCH) 23.5 pg specifically refers to the average weight of hemoglobin inside a single red blood cell. To understand this, let's break down what hemoglobin is and why it matters. Hemoglobin is a protein found within red blood cells, and its main job is to pick up oxygen in the lungs and carry it through the bloodstream to all the tissues and organs in your body. It also helps transport carbon dioxide back to the lungs to be exhaled. Think of hemoglobin as the delivery truck for oxygen; without enough of these 'trucks' or if they are not fully loaded, oxygen delivery might not be as efficient. A lower MCH value, like 23.5 pg, suggests that on average, your red blood cells are carrying less hemoglobin. This can happen for a couple of main reasons. Either the red blood cells themselves are smaller than usual, or they contain a lower concentration of hemoglobin, even if their size is typical. In essence, the 'trucks' might be smaller or less full. The term 'picogram' (pg) is a unit of measurement that quantifies this tiny amount of hemoglobin, giving a precise numerical value to something happening at a microscopic level. Understanding MCH helps healthcare providers get a clearer picture of your red blood cell characteristics, which is important because red blood cells are critical for life. They are constantly being produced in the bone marrow, circulating for about 120 days, and then broken down and recycled. This continuous cycle requires a steady supply of building blocks, especially certain vitamins and minerals. When MCH is lower than expected, it can be a sign that something is impacting this intricate process, potentially affecting the body's ability to produce healthy, fully functional red blood cells. For instance, common reasons for lower MCH often relate to the availability of specific nutrients. The body needs key ingredients to make hemoglobin and red blood cells properly. Without these essential components, the red blood cells that are produced may not be optimal in size or hemoglobin content. This is why a Mean Corpuscular Hemoglobin (MCH) 23.5 pg result is often considered in conjunction with other measurements from a blood panel, such as Mean Corpuscular Volume (MCV), which measures the average size of red blood cells. Diet Changes for Mean Corpuscular Hemoglobin (MCH) 23.5 pg

When considering a Mean Corpuscular Hemoglobin (MCH) 23.5 pg measurement, dietary choices become a particularly relevant area to explore, as nutrition plays a foundational role in the production of healthy red blood cells and the hemoglobin they contain. The body relies on a steady supply of specific vitamins and minerals to create these essential components. Iron is perhaps the most well-known nutrient for hemoglobin formation, as it's a central part of the hemoglobin molecule itself. Without enough iron, the body struggles to produce sufficient hemoglobin, which can lead to red blood cells that are smaller and paler than usual, resulting in a lower MCH. Foods rich in iron include lean red meats, poultry, fish, beans, lentils, spinach, fortified cereals, and dried fruits. Consuming vitamin C alongside plant-based iron sources can enhance iron absorption, making foods like oranges, bell peppers, and broccoli beneficial additions. Another crucial nutrient is Vitamin B12, which is vital for red blood cell maturation. A deficiency in B12 can lead to the production of abnormally large, immature red blood cells (a different type of anemia), but it can also be part of a complex picture affecting MCH in various ways. Sources of Vitamin B12 are primarily animal products like meat, fish, eggs, and dairy, as well as fortified plant-based foods. Folate, or Vitamin B9, works closely with Vitamin B12 in red blood cell production. A lack of folate can also impact the formation of healthy red blood cells. Leafy green vegetables, fruits, nuts, beans, and fortified grains are excellent sources of folate. Copper, while needed in smaller amounts, is essential for the body to absorb and utilize iron properly. Foods like nuts, seeds, whole grains, and shellfish provide copper. Mean Corpuscular Hemoglobin (MCH) 23.5 pg in Men, Women, Elderly, and Kids

The Mean Corpuscular Hemoglobin (MCH) 23.5 pg value and what it signifies can sometimes vary slightly in its interpretation across different demographic groups, including men, women, the elderly, and children. It's important to remember that 'normal' is often a range, not a single fixed number, and various physiological factors can influence these measurements. For women, particularly during their reproductive years, lower MCH values are sometimes more commonly observed due to factors like menstrual blood loss. This regular loss of blood can lead to a greater susceptibility to iron deficiency, which directly impacts hemoglobin production and, consequently, MCH levels. Pregnancy also significantly increases the body's demand for iron and other nutrients, making pregnant women more prone to lower MCH if their nutritional intake isn't adequately managed. The body’s need for iron almost doubles during pregnancy to support both the mother and the developing baby. In contrast, adult men generally have higher iron stores and are less frequently found with iron deficiency unless there's an underlying issue causing blood loss. Therefore, a Mean Corpuscular Hemoglobin (MCH) 23.5 pg in an adult male might prompt a different set of investigative questions compared to the same value in a premenopausal woman, leading healthcare providers to consider different potential causes. For children, particularly infants and toddlers undergoing rapid growth spurts, their nutritional needs are intense. Deficiencies in iron and other essential vitamins can easily develop if their diet isn't sufficiently rich. Lower MCH values in children could indicate nutritional inadequacies impacting their growth and development, making early detection and intervention crucial. Pediatricians carefully monitor these values to ensure children are receiving appropriate nutrition for healthy blood cell formation. As people age, the elderly population can also experience changes that affect MCH. Factors such as decreased appetite, absorption issues due due to changes in the digestive system, chronic health conditions, and interactions with multiple medications can all contribute to nutritional deficiencies, including iron and B vitamins. This can sometimes lead to lower MCH values, which may be part of a broader picture of health challenges in older adults. Medicine Effects on Mean Corpuscular Hemoglobin (MCH) 23.5 pg

Many different types of medications can impact the body's intricate systems, sometimes influencing blood test results, including Mean Corpuscular Hemoglobin (MCH) 23.5 pg. It's important to understand that these effects are often complex and depend on the specific medication, dosage, duration of use, and an individual's unique physiological response. Certain medications can interfere with nutrient absorption, which is critical for healthy red blood cell and hemoglobin production. For example, some drugs used to reduce stomach acid can, over time, decrease the absorption of Vitamin B12 and iron, two nutrients essential for MCH. Similarly, medications used to manage certain chronic conditions might affect how the body processes or utilizes nutrients. Other medicines can directly influence the bone marrow, where blood cells are produced. While less common, some powerful drugs, such as certain chemotherapy agents or immunosuppressants, can suppress bone marrow activity, leading to changes in various blood cell counts, including those that influence MCH. Anti-inflammatory drugs, when used chronically, can sometimes cause subtle blood loss in the digestive tract, which over time could lead to iron deficiency and a lower MCH.
